After initial confusion, about the identity of the gunman who killed 26 chidlren and adults when he opened fire at the school, authorities revealed it was Ryan’s younger brother 20-year-old Adam who was believed to be responsible. He was found dead at the scene.
But it didn’t stop the storm of outrage on social media and the sharing of his photo with comments like ‘‘this is the ass hole that killed 20 innocent kindergarden kids & 7 adults.’’
Friends of Ryan Lanza have been reporting on US webpage Businessinsider saying that he has been defending himself on facebook posting comments saying ‘‘IT WASN’T ME I WAS AT WORK IT WASNT ME’’.
